Why Live in Reserve

Reserve, a small community along the Mississippi River, is located 30 miles from New Orleans and is known for its quiet, rural atmosphere. With a population of 8,500, Reserve offers a slower-paced lifestyle where residents enjoy fishing and community events like church fish fries. The area features a mix of vintage cottages, brick ranch houses, and newer Acadian-style homes, often on larger lots compared to urban areas. Job opportunities are plentiful at the nearby chemical plants, though the Environmental Protection Agency notes higher cancer rates in the region. Dining options include Rotolo’s Pizzeria for Detroit-style pies with a Creole twist and Yaba’s Café for unique dishes like shrimp stuffed burgers. For groceries, locals shop at Gregg’s Neighborhood Market or the Walmart Supercenter in LaPlace, 5 miles away. Regala Park provides recreational activities with its playground, Little League baseball fields, and pool, while the Mississippi River Trail offers a scenic route for runners and bikers. The Maurepas Swamp Wildlife Management Area, a 10-mile drive away, is ideal for birdwatching, kayaking, and hiking. Cultural events are held at the St. John Theatre, and Our Lady of Grace Catholic Church hosts regular fish fries. Public schools in Reserve are part of the St. John the Baptist Parish Public Schools, with efforts to enhance computer literacy by providing students with laptops. The River Parishes Community College’s Reserve Campus offers career training in various fields.
